Job Description
•Guides, directs and coordinates the strategic planning of the Regulatory Affairs BioScience advertising and promotion function. Applies critical review skills and creative solutions to diverse promotional scenarios
•Communicates directly with the FDA on advertising and promotional labeling-related activities.
•Ensures that advertising and promotional labeling materials meet FDA and Baxter standards.
•Directs the activities of Regulatory Affairs staff relative to milestones and timelines. Provides appropriate staffing for the Regulatory Affairs function, in accordance with projected product/project needs. Trains and develops staff as appropriate.
•Ensures, through regular communication, that regulatory activities support business and marketing needs. Liaises with a matrixed review team including Marketing, Legal, Medical and Engineering disciplines as relevant
•Surveys, evaluates and interprets regulatory requirements relative to advertising and promotional labeling and disseminates information and impact of changes in regulatory policies to appropriate management.
•Educates departments regarding required regulatory compliance.
Job Requirements
•Experience working directly with OPDP/ DDMAC or APLB is a must.
•Expert knowledge of regulations and their interpretation, implementation and specific experience in the area of advertising and promotion and the ability to support of multiple commercial products are required.
•Excellent written and verbal communication skills and computer literacy are required.
•Demonstrated leadership skills and demonstrated ability to interact with senior management.
•Orientation to teamwork, problem-solving ability, customer focus, and a commitment to quality are essential.
•Risk management and problem solving skills
•Ability to lead, mentor, and develop others for future growth and development
•Advanced Degree or country equivalent in related scientific discipline with a minimum of 10 years experience in RA, Higher degree/PhD will be an advantage. International experience/exposure preferred.
